Discover cheap things to do in London (and vicinity)
For budget-conscious travellers seeking to explore the greater London area, there are plenty of affordable attractions that will delight the whole family. Start your journey at the iconic British Museum, where entry is free and you can marvel at priceless artefacts from around the world, including the Rosetta Stone and Egyptian mummies. Just a short walk away, the vibrant streets of Camden Town offer a feast for the senses, with its bustling market and diverse street food options that won’t break the bank—try a delicious vegan burger or mouth-watering pulled pork from one of the many stalls. For a dose of nature, the sprawling expanse of Hyde Park is perfect for a leisurely picnic or a free open-air concert on summer weekends. If you’re keen on culture, check out the Tate Modern, another free museum showcasing contemporary art, or take a stroll along the South Bank, where you can enjoy street performers and pop-up food markets.
